Having played in bands since 1995 without any significant kind of success, what remains are plenty of stories to tell. Stories about growing up during the Nineties, learning about punk and hardcore, meeting great people on tour around the world, starting and ending bands and the love and heartbreak that went along with it.

#19: (German) Daniel Benyamin (Ghost Palace Records)

Wir haben den ersten returning guest zu vermelden, der Musiker und Musikverrückte Daniel Benyamin ist wieder zu Gast, und nachdem wir in Folge 10 eher über die Vergangenheit gesprochen haben, geht es in dieser Folge um die Gegenwart, in der viel Interessantes zu erzählen ist. Unter anderem geht es um diese Themen:

- warum der Musikbranche wieder mehr DIY und Idealismus gut zu Gesicht stehen würde,

- der freiwillige Verzicht aufs 9 to 5 Leben im Tausch gegen regelmäßige Existenzängste und Strategien, mit diesen klarzukommen,

- Daniel erzählt über Ghost Palace, sein Labelkollektiv/Kollektivlabel, bei dem zwischenzeitlich der große Wim Wenders beteiligt war (den ich peinlicherweise im Gespräch Wim Hof nenne),

- wie es dazu kam, dass seine neue Platte Eral Fun so nach 80s-Pop klingt, obwohl er musikalisch neunziger-sozialisiert ist (falls ihr euch erinnert, die 90er waren quasi die Anti-80er),

- die eigentlich unwichtige aber trotzdem spannende Frage, ob man mit oder ohne Click Drums aufnimmt,

- und noch mehr
